A magnetic field dependence and a simultaneous switching in vertically stacked Josephson junctions.

Abstract(in English) We have fabricated the vertically stacked Josephson junctions with different thicknesses (4,8,14,20,40nm)for the intermediate Nb layer.In the double junction,the simultaneous switching between the lower and the upper junction is observed.Though a simultaneous switching is also observed in the series-connected Josephson junction,some differences only in the double junction with thin intermediate Nb layers such as 4nm or 8nm are observed.We have investigated the condition of this by the magnetic field dependence of the critical currents.
